Proven solutions for a better night's sleep, from the "sleep guru" to elite athletes--rest for success in work, sports, and life

One-third of our lives -- that's 3,000 hours a year--is spent trying to sleep. The time we spend in bed shapes our moods, motivation, alertness, decision-making skills, reaction time, creativity . . . in short, our ability to perform, whether at work, at home, or at play. But most of us have disturbed, restless nights, relying on over-stimulation from caffeine and sugar to drag us through the day. The old eight-hour rule just doesn't work, and it's time for a new approach.

Endorsed by leading professionals in sports and business, Sleep shares a new program to be your personal best. Nick Littlehales is the leading sport sleep coach to some of the biggest names in the sporting world, including record-breaking cyclists for British Cycling and Team Sky, international soccer teams, NBA and NFL players, and Olympic and Paralympic athletes. Here, he shares his proven strategies for anyone to use. You'll learn how to map your unique sleep cycle, optimize your environment for recovery, and cope with the demands of this fast-paced, tech-driven world. The book itself delivers an eye-opening concept of implementing sleep cycles as the guide to achieve better sleep. I enjoyed the fact that the author delved into the concept of why sleep cycles matter and debunked the common misconception of "quality" sleep.

I gave it 4 stars because I wished the book went further into creating a sleeping pack. Recommendations on building a custom sleeping pack didn't mention too much on the Why's, but rather glossed over a basic construction of it.

Overall a great and powerful book if readers/listeners can implement the concept into their own lives. It has definitely helped me.
